C# Class UnityEditor.PlaymodeTestsRunner.XmlResultWriter

显示文件 Open project: CarlosHBC/UnityDecompiled

Public Methods

Method Description
GetTestResult ( ) : string
WriteToFile ( string resultDestiantion, string resultFileName ) : void
XmlResultWriter ( string suiteName, string platform, TestResult results ) : System

Private Methods

Method Description
EnvironmentGetCurrentDirectory ( ) : string
GetEnvironmentMachineName ( ) : string
GetEnvironmentOSVersion ( ) : string
GetEnvironmentOSVersionPlatform ( ) : string
GetEnvironmentUserDomainName ( ) : string
GetEnvironmentUserName ( ) : string
GetEnvironmentVersion ( ) : string
InitializeXmlFile ( string resultsName, ResultSummarizer summaryResults ) : void
StartTestElement ( TestResult result ) : void
TerminateXmlFile ( ) : void
WriteCData ( string text ) : void
WriteClosingElement ( string elementName ) : void
WriteCultureInfo ( ) : void
WriteEnvironment ( string targetPlatform ) : void
WriteFailureElement ( TestResult result ) : void
WriteHeader ( ) : void
WriteIndent ( ) : void
WriteOpeningElement ( string elementName ) : void
WriteOpeningElement ( string elementName, string>.Dictionary attributes ) : void
WriteOpeningElement ( string elementName, string>.Dictionary attributes, bool closeImmediatelly ) : void
WriteReasonElement ( TestResult result ) : void
WriteResultElement ( TestResult result ) : void
WriteTestSuite ( string resultsName, ResultSummarizer summaryResults ) : void

Method Details

GetTestResult() public method

public GetTestResult ( ) : string
return string

WriteToFile() public method

public WriteToFile ( string resultDestiantion, string resultFileName ) : void
resultDestiantion string
resultFileName string
return void

XmlResultWriter() public method

public XmlResultWriter ( string suiteName, string platform, TestResult results ) : System
suiteName string
platform string
results TestResult
return System